Carolina won the NHL's Eastern Conference by a four-point margin. In the round of 16, they recorded four straight victories against Ottawa, and there are many indications that the quarterfinal series against Philadelphia will end similarly.
In the third meeting between the teams there was no contest. Carolina walked away with a 4–1 win and thus has match point. If the team wins again on Sunday night, a semifinal spot would be secured in the fewest possible number of games (8).
In the semifinals, Carolina would face either Buffalo or Montreal, who have already played seven and eight playoff games, respectively, even though those teams have met only once in their quarterfinal series so far.
